Which City is Right for You?
Glendale leads in median household income at $84,262, while palm Bay offers more affordable housing with a median home price of $304,173. On public safety, Palm Bay is safer with a violent crime rate of 324 per 100,000 residents, compared to 503 in Glendale. Palm Bay has a lower unemployment rate at 5.9%, and Palm Bay has cleaner air (PM2.5 avg 7.2 µg/m³). For overall health outcomes, Glendale scores better with a lower obesity rate of 24.5%.
